They are both very capable players but they will be learning to play a different defense. I'm guessing Damone Clark will be a middle linebacker cause of his size. While Baskerville will be a sam linebacker. While Jacoby Stevens will be moved to the will linebacker spot. All speculation on my part though.
The good thing is Bo Pelini, according to former LSU players is an excellent linebacker coach.
Now, I am a little concerned about the position group cause we are going to be a little thin in the depth department. As no one was anticipating McCallum to transfer and everyone was sort of expecting Patrick Queen to return for one more season, but hell, he improved himself into a first-round player. I didn't see that one coming. I don't think anyone did.

Honestly I prefer keeping Hampton up top at FS. When he, Delpit, and Stevens were in, our pass coverage really took a step up. I look for Hampton/Harris/Monroe? At FS, with Jacoby becoming an All-American at SS
I kind of agree, but I think cause of his size and lack of experienced players that Jacoby Stevens will be moved to the Will Linebacker spot.
While Marcel Brooks will be moved to the Strong Safety spot. As I can really see Marcel Brooks blitzing the QB up the middle a lot and generally wreaking havoc all over the field like Chad Jones used to do. I really think that guy can be that kind of player for LSU.
Now a lot of people want Marcel Brooks to remain as a third-down pass rush specialist only. However, for me, Marcel Brooks is far too talented a player to only be used in such a manner. I would much prefer we put his many talents to work for us at the Strong Safety position and as an every-down player, while Jacoby Stevens manages the Will Linebacker spot.
